Abstract
The purpose of entrepreneurial training as stipulated by the European Commission 2008, among others include; raising awareness of students about business skills, knowledge, promoting creativity, innovation and self-employment. This calls for entrepreneurial education that will enhance the students upon graduation to be fitted in the dynamic society. This includes the acquisition of skills in areas that will be useful to business students and make them self reliant, independent and productive citizens of the society. This research therefore examines, the concepts of Business education, and the constrain to the teaching of this course in our tertiary institution.
